Time | Implementation | Compiler | Benchmark date | SUPERCOP version |
21519 | cryptopp | g++ -funroll-loops -fno-schedule-insns -O3 -fomit-frame-pointer | 20140506 | 20140425 |
21692 | cryptopp | g++ -mcpu=cortex-a9 -O2 -fomit-frame-pointer | 20140506 | 20140425 |
21711 | cryptopp | g++ -mcpu=cortex-a9 -O3 -fomit-frame-pointer | 20140506 | 20140425 |
21734 | cryptopp | g++ -mcpu=cortex-a9 -mfloat-abi=hard -mfpu=neon -O3 -fomit-frame-pointer | 20140506 | 20140425 |
21922 | cryptopp | g++ -funroll-loops -fno-schedule-insns -O -fomit-frame-pointer | 20140506 | 20140425 |
21946 | cryptopp | g++ -mcpu=cortex-a9 -mfloat-abi=hard -mfpu=neon -O2 -fomit-frame-pointer | 20140506 | 20140425 |
22044 | cryptopp | g++ -O2 -fomit-frame-pointer | 20140506 | 20140425 |
22044 | cryptopp | g++ -fno-schedule-insns -O -fomit-frame-pointer | 20140506 | 20140425 |
22057 | cryptopp | g++ -fno-schedule-insns -O2 -fomit-frame-pointer | 20140506 | 20140425 |
22060 | cryptopp | g++ -O3 -fomit-frame-pointer | 20140506 | 20140425 |
22066 | cryptopp | g++ -mcpu=cortex-a9 -O -fomit-frame-pointer | 20140506 | 20140425 |
22073 | cryptopp | g++ -mcpu=cortex-a9 -mfloat-abi=hard -mfpu=neon -O -fomit-frame-pointer | 20140506 | 20140425 |
22074 | cryptopp | g++ -mcpu=cortex-a5 -O3 -fomit-frame-pointer | 20140506 | 20140425 |
22098 | cryptopp | g++ -funroll-loops -fno-schedule-insns -O2 -fomit-frame-pointer | 20140506 | 20140425 |
22121 | cryptopp | g++ -fno-schedule-insns -O3 -fomit-frame-pointer | 20140506 | 20140425 |
22203 | cryptopp | g++ -mcpu=cortex-a5 -O2 -fomit-frame-pointer | 20140506 | 20140425 |
22230 | cryptopp | g++ -mcpu=arm8 -O3 -fomit-frame-pointer | 20140506 | 20140425 |
22238 | cryptopp | g++ -mcpu=strongarm -O3 -fomit-frame-pointer | 20140506 | 20140425 |
22266 | cryptopp | g++ -mcpu=strongarm110 -O3 -fomit-frame-pointer | 20140506 | 20140425 |
22318 | cryptopp | g++ -O -fomit-frame-pointer | 20140506 | 20140425 |
22327 | cryptopp | g++ -mcpu=arm810 -O3 -fomit-frame-pointer | 20140506 | 20140425 |
22366 | cryptopp | g++ -mcpu=cortex-a8 -mfloat-abi=hard -mfpu=neon -O3 -fomit-frame-pointer | 20140506 | 20140425 |
22377 | cryptopp | g++ -mcpu=arm8 -O -fomit-frame-pointer | 20140506 | 20140425 |
22421 | cryptopp | g++ -mcpu=cortex-a5 -O -fomit-frame-pointer | 20140506 | 20140425 |
22427 | cryptopp | g++ -mcpu=strongarm1100 -O3 -fomit-frame-pointer | 20140506 | 20140425 |
22453 | cryptopp | g++ -mcpu=arm810 -O -fomit-frame-pointer | 20140506 | 20140425 |
22513 | cryptopp | g++ -mcpu=arm8 -O2 -fomit-frame-pointer | 20140506 | 20140425 |
22513 | cryptopp | g++ -mcpu=cortex-a8 -mfloat-abi=hard -mfpu=neon -O -fomit-frame-pointer | 20140506 | 20140425 |
22545 | cryptopp | g++ -mcpu=strongarm110 -O2 -fomit-frame-pointer | 20140506 | 20140425 |
22574 | cryptopp | g++ -mcpu=strongarm -O2 -fomit-frame-pointer | 20140506 | 20140425 |
22586 | cryptopp | g++ -mcpu=cortex-a8 -mfloat-abi=hard -mfpu=neon -O2 -fomit-frame-pointer | 20140506 | 20140425 |
22641 | cryptopp | g++ -mcpu=cortex-a5 -Os -fomit-frame-pointer | 20140506 | 20140425 |
22644 | cryptopp | g++ -mcpu=strongarm1100 -O2 -fomit-frame-pointer | 20140506 | 20140425 |
22646 | cryptopp | g++ -mcpu=arm810 -O2 -fomit-frame-pointer | 20140506 | 20140425 |
22670 | cryptopp | g++ -mcpu=cortex-a9 -Os -fomit-frame-pointer | 20140506 | 20140425 |
22701 | cryptopp | g++ -mcpu=strongarm1100 -O -fomit-frame-pointer | 20140506 | 20140425 |
22781 | cryptopp | g++ -Os -fomit-frame-pointer | 20140506 | 20140425 |
22817 | cryptopp | g++ -mcpu=strongarm -O -fomit-frame-pointer | 20140506 | 20140425 |
22824 | cryptopp | g++ -mcpu=strongarm110 -O -fomit-frame-pointer | 20140506 | 20140425 |
22829 | cryptopp | g++ -mcpu=cortex-a8 -mfloat-abi=hard -mfpu=neon -Os -fomit-frame-pointer | 20140506 | 20140425 |
22931 | cryptopp | g++ -mcpu=cortex-a9 -mfloat-abi=hard -mfpu=neon -Os -fomit-frame-pointer | 20140506 | 20140425 |
22969 | cryptopp | g++ -fno-schedule-insns -Os -fomit-frame-pointer | 20140506 | 20140425 |
23116 | cryptopp | g++ -funroll-loops -fno-schedule-insns -Os -fomit-frame-pointer | 20140506 | 20140425 |
23256 | cryptopp | g++ -mcpu=arm8 -Os -fomit-frame-pointer | 20140506 | 20140425 |
23317 | cryptopp | g++ -mcpu=arm810 -Os -fomit-frame-pointer | 20140506 | 20140425 |
23329 | cryptopp | g++ -mcpu=strongarm -Os -fomit-frame-pointer | 20140506 | 20140425 |
23505 | cryptopp | g++ -mcpu=strongarm110 -Os -fomit-frame-pointer | 20140506 | 20140425 |
24267 | cryptopp | g++ -mcpu=strongarm1100 -Os -fomit-frame-pointer | 20140506 | 20140425 |
28054 | cryptopp | g++ | 20140506 | 20140425 |
Compiler | Implementations
|
cc | e/submissions/sosemanuk |
gcc | e/submissions/sosemanuk |
gcc -O2 -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-O3 -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-O -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-Os -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-fno-schedule-insns -O2 -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-fno-schedule-insns -O3 -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-fno-schedule-insns -O -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-fno-schedule-insns -Os -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-funroll-loops | e/submissions/sosemanuk |
gcc -funroll-loops -O2 -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-funroll-loops -O3 -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-funroll-loops -O -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-funroll-loops -Os -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-funroll-loops -fno-schedule-insns -O2 -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-funroll-loops -fno-schedule-insns -O3 -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-funroll-loops -fno-schedule-insns -O -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-funroll-loops -fno-schedule-insns -Os -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=cortex-a5 -O2 -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=cortex-a5 -O3 -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=cortex-a5 -O -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=cortex-a5 -Os -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=cortex-a8 -mfloat-abi=hard -mfpu=neon -O2 -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=cortex-a8 -mfloat-abi=hard -mfpu=neon -O3 -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=cortex-a8 -mfloat-abi=hard -mfpu=neon -O -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=cortex-a8 -mfloat-abi=hard -mfpu=neon -Os -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=cortex-a9 -O2 -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=cortex-a9 -O3 -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=cortex-a9 -O -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=cortex-a9 -Os -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=cortex-a9 -mfloat-abi=hard -mfpu=neon -O2 -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=cortex-a9 -mfloat-abi=hard -mfpu=neon -O3 -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=cortex-a9 -mfloat-abi=hard -mfpu=neon -O -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=cortex-a9 -mfloat-abi=hard -mfpu=neon -Os -fomit-frame-pointer | e/submissions/sosemanuk
|
Compiler | Implementations
|
g++ -mcpu=arm810 -O2 -fomit-frame-pointer | cryptopp |
g++ -mcpu=arm810 -O3 -fomit-frame-pointer | cryptopp |
g++ -mcpu=arm810 -O -fomit-frame-pointer | cryptopp |
g++ -mcpu=arm810 -Os -fomit-frame-pointer | cryptopp |
g++ -mcpu=arm8 -O2 -fomit-frame-pointer | cryptopp |
g++ -mcpu=arm8 -O3 -fomit-frame-pointer | cryptopp |
g++ -mcpu=arm8 -O -fomit-frame-pointer | cryptopp |
g++ -mcpu=arm8 -Os -fomit-frame-pointer | cryptopp |
g++ -mcpu=strongarm1100 -O2 -fomit-frame-pointer | cryptopp |
g++ -mcpu=strongarm1100 -O3 -fomit-frame-pointer | cryptopp |
g++ -mcpu=strongarm1100 -O -fomit-frame-pointer | cryptopp |
g++ -mcpu=strongarm1100 -Os -fomit-frame-pointer | cryptopp |
g++ -mcpu=strongarm110 -O2 -fomit-frame-pointer | cryptopp |
g++ -mcpu=strongarm110 -O3 -fomit-frame-pointer | cryptopp |
g++ -mcpu=strongarm110 -O -fomit-frame-pointer | cryptopp |
g++ -mcpu=strongarm110 -Os -fomit-frame-pointer | cryptopp |
g++ -mcpu=strongarm -O2 -fomit-frame-pointer | cryptopp |
g++ -mcpu=strongarm -O3 -fomit-frame-pointer | cryptopp |
g++ -mcpu=strongarm -O -fomit-frame-pointer | cryptopp |
g++ -mcpu=strongarm -Os -fomit-frame-pointer | cryptopp
|
Compiler | Implementations
|
gcc -mcpu=arm810 -O2 -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=arm810 -O3 -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=arm810 -O -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=arm810 -Os -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=arm8 -O2 -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=arm8 -O3 -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=arm8 -O -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=arm8 -Os -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=strongarm1100 -O2 -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=strongarm1100 -O3 -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=strongarm1100 -O -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=strongarm1100 -Os -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=strongarm110 -O2 -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=strongarm110 -O3 -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=strongarm110 -O -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=strongarm110 -Os -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=strongarm -O2 -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=strongarm -O3 -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=strongarm -O -fomit-frame-pointer | e/submissions/sosemanuk |
gcc -mcpu=strongarm -Os -fomit-frame-pointer | e/submissions/sosemanuk
|